Planning a meal for a crowd?

Washington, DC has you covered with group-friendly restaurants that serve up great food, ample seating and welcoming vibes. From casual bites to upscale favorites, these spots cater to all tastes and group sizes, so you can focus on the fun, not the logistics. Here are some of the best places in DC to dine with a group.
